Business partner of local plant management providing financial support for Manufacturing Section under guidance of Section Manager and Plant Controller, focusing on section specific cost budgeting, actual performance tracking, gap analysis between standard and actual performance ensuring fulfilment of Section’s Key Performance Indicators (KPIs).

Support / provide financial KPI data for DMS (daily management system) – IL6S

You will:

  • Determine facts and figures from the section in order to prepare Section’s budget and forecasts and ensure regular tracking of it, adherence to budget figures and reporting of deviations.
  • Track actual performance against relevant KPI’s, production standard of the conversion process in the section including material, DVL, DVE consumption and section specific fixed cost. Use of controlling tools to measure deviations.
  • Support timely and accurate product costing calculations, report deviations. Identify main cost drivers for further productivity potential within the section.
  • Ensure collection, check integrity of shift data (e.g. Process Orders system info, timesheet info) in order to produce correct calculations.
  • Provide support and guidance on section related KPIs.
  • Ensure timely and accurate reporting of section specific costs and provide analysis on section related ad hoc requests. (Plant reporting will be covered by conversion controlling team.)
  • Guarantee strict compliance with relevant financial policies and procedures within the section.
  • Support the monthly financial closing process, including accruals, production orders settlement, variance analysis and reporting
  • CRITICAL: Ownership and accountability of weekly cost governance. (DVL, losses, M&R …)
  • Support the monthly financial closing process, including accruals, production orders settlement, variance analysis and reporting
  • Contribute to the budgeting and forecasting process by preparing financial analyses and coordinating the collection of relevant data and assumptions from stakeholders
  • Supporting ongoing cost optimization efforts / IL6S manufacturing initiatives.
  • Ensure consistent and accurate data inputs across systems for reliable reporting.

Mondelēz International, Inc. (NASDAQ: MDLZ) is an American multinational confectionery, food, and beverage company based in Illinois which employs approximately 80,000 individuals around the world.

Our Purpose

Our purpose is to empower people to snack right. We will lead the future of snacking around the world by offering the right snack, for the right moment, made the right way.

Our Brands

We’re leading the future of snacking with iconic brands such as Oreo, belVita and LU biscuits; Cadbury Dairy Milk, Milka and Toblerone chocolate; Sour Patch Kids candy and Trident gum.
